Exploring Horizons: Land of the Giants - San Teadoro Sardinia, Italy is a nature documentary that takes viewers on a breathtaking journey through one of the most beautiful and untouched regions of the world. The movie follows a team of expert adventurers as they explore the rugged terrain of San Teadoro, a stunning coastal region located on the island of Sardinia in Italy.
The documentary showcases the natural beauty of Sardinia's coastline, highlighting its striking cliffs, crystal clear waters, and uncanny rock formations dating back to ancient times. The film takes viewers on a stunning aerial tour of the region, soaring above the rocky landscapes of Capo Coda Cavallo, Isola Tavolara, and La Maddalena Archipelago. The mesmerizing bird's-eye view of the coast is a real visual treat for anyone interested in exploration or outdoor adventure.
The movie captures the unique environment of the region while inspiring viewers to appreciate the wilderness and understand the significance of conservation efforts. The team also undertakes an up-close investigation of the vast network of caves that dot the region's rocky coastline, explaining their geological formation and how they have been used throughout history. The team's deep dive into the caves offers a sense of awe, adventure, and danger.
The documentary team takes advantage of Sardinia's calm waters to explore the vast underwater landscape of San Teadoro. They document the region's rich marine life, including sea turtles, dolphins, and even a rare sighting of a giant octopus in its natural habitat. The film crew's expertly edited underwater cinematography captures the mysterious beauty of the sea and is a magical experience for both underwater enthusiasts and those who have never seen such wonders before.
As the explorers journey inland, they visit the ancient Nuragic people's ruins, an enigmatic civilization that lived in Sardinia's rugged landscape thousands of years ago. The team sheds light on the culture of the Nuragic people and their fascinating archeological beliefs in nature spirits and village deities. The ruins of the primitive village convey a sense of mystery and ethereal wonder, inviting viewers to imagine life in ancient times.
